The Incredibly Great Novak Djokovic Eases To A Record 8th Australian Open Crown, Naomi Osaka Wins Her Second Straight Major, Also “Down There”

January 27, 2019

Novak Djokovic won his third straight major tennis tournament and fifteenth of his incredible career, completely outplaying another great, Rafael Nadal to win the final match held earlier today in Australia, in straight (the minimum three) sets.

This is Djokovic’s 7th Australian Open crown, breaking a record he shared with Roy Emerson and Roger Federer. He moved by Pete Sampras into third place in major tournament wins, trailing only Federer (20) and Nadal with 17.

Meanwhile, Naomi Osaka won her second straight woman’s major crown, defeating Petra Kvitova, in a very tough maximum (3) set match.

Perhaps Ms. Osaka is on her way to greatness, while Mr. Djokovic already there moved closer to a special pantheon of that all too often used term (greatness), easing by Nadal, who had not lost even a set, before Djokovic eased (6-3, 6-2 and 6-3).
